Change Expiry for Uploaded Videos

If your uploaded videos on Minvo are expiring too soon, you can customize their expiry settings to match your needs. This article walks you through how to change the expiry date or remove expiry altogether for videos you’ve uploaded.

Step-by-Step: How to Change Expiry Settings

1. Go to Your Video Library

  • From your Minvo dashboard, navigate to the Video Library tab.

2. Select the Video

  • Click on the thumbnail or title of the video whose expiry you want to modify.

3. Click on “Edit Settings” or “More Options”

  • Click on the 3 dots (:)

4. Change the Expiry Date

  • Under the expiry section, set a new expiry date.

5. Save Changes

  • Click "Update" to confirm the new expiry setting.

Additional Tips

  • Check Permissions: If you're part of a team, some expiry settings may be managed by an admin.

  • Expiry Notifications: Your video must be valid and not expired before editing.
